Galician

Etymology

From bacía + -eiro, from Vulgar Latin *baccinum, from Celtic. Cognate with Portuguese bacia and Spanish bacín.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/baθiˈejɾo̝/, (western) /basiˈejɾo̝/

Noun

bacieiro m (plural bacieiros)

  1. trough
    Synonyms: bacía, bacío
  2. chamber pot
    Synonym: penico
